
Historical context and known paranormal claims surrounding Cedarburg Woolen Mill.
The Cedarburg Woolen Mill represents a significant chapter in Wisconsin's industrial heritage, constructed during the nineteenth century to process raw wool into finished textile products for distribution throughout the upper Midwest. The facility was built to capitalize on the region's access to both raw materials and efficient waterpower, which was essential for operating the heavy machinery required in industrial fabric production. The mill's architecture reflects the utilitarian design principles of its era, with sturdy brick construction, large windows positioned to maximize natural light for workers, and an internal layout optimized for the sequential processing of wool materials. During its operational years, the mill employed dozens of workers who labored in close quarters to transform fleece into usable cloth, creating an environment marked by constant noise, physical exertion, and the ever-present machinery that characterized factory work in the industrial age.
The mill operated successfully through much of the nineteenth and early twentieth centuries, serving as an economic anchor for the community of Cedarburg and providing steady employment for generations of local families. The facility witnessed countless personal dramas, from romances that blossomed among the workers to tragic accidents involving the heavy machinery that defined factory hazards of the era. The mill's interior became a second home to many workers who spent more waking hours within its walls than in their own residences, creating a sense of belonging and community that transcended the purely commercial nature of the enterprise. However, the transition to industrial decline and the mechanization of textile production elsewhere eventually led to the mill's closure and transformation into a historical landmark.
Following the cessation of regular operations, reports of paranormal activity began accumulating from visitors and paranormal investigators exploring the vacant facility. Accounts describe encounters with a disembodied face that appears to float through the mill's interior, manifesting without corresponding body or visible physical form. This apparition has been observed by multiple witnesses in various locations throughout the structure, with descriptions suggesting a visage suspended in mid-air, emerging from the darkness of the mill's shadowy corridors and chambers. The phenomenon defies conventional understanding, as the disconnected face appears capable of movement and possible intentional interaction with observers. The nature of this manifestation remains unexplained, raising questions about the circumstances that may have led to such an unusual paranormal presentation.
Investigators and casual visitors have reported additional unexplained phenomena occurring throughout the mill's interior, including unexplained sounds, mysterious movement of objects, and sensations of being observed or followed through the corridors. The atmosphere within the Cedarburg Woolen Mill carries a weight that many describe as oppressive or melancholic, with visitors frequently reporting feelings of sadness or heaviness that cannot be attributed to the building's deteriorated physical condition alone. Some researchers have proposed that the mill's industrial history, combined with the numerous individuals who labored within its walls across generations, may have created an environment conducive to residual paranormal phenomena. The disembodied face continues to be reported by visitors today, maintaining its mysterious presence within the Cedarburg Woolen Mill and attracting continued investigation from paranormal researchers seeking to understand this unusual manifestation.
